Krasnoufimsk vs Churchill Falls, Nf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Krasnoufimsk, Russia and Churchill Falls, Nf, Canada is approximately 6,676 km or 4,149 mi.
  • To reach Krasnoufimsk in this distance one would set out from Churchill Falls, Nf bearing 32.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Krasnoufimsk bearing 144.4° or SE .
  • Krasnoufimsk has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Churchill Falls, Nf has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Krasnoufimsk is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Churchill Falls, Nf is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ome.
  • The mean temperature is 4.9 °C (8.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.8 °C (1.4°F) less in Krasnoufimsk.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 395.6 mm (15.6 in) less which is equivalent to 395.6 l/m² (9.71 US gal/ft²) or 3,956,000 l/ha (422,923 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.1° lower in Krasnoufimsk than in Churchill Falls, Nf.
